摘    要:目的:研究三叶因子3、基质细胞衍生因子-1(SDF-1)及其受体CXCR4在甲状腺乳头状癌(PTC),中的表达,探讨三者在乳头状癌发生、发展和转归中的作用及相关性。方法:应用免疫组织化学法(SP法)检测92例PTC及癌旁组织中TFF3、SDF-1及CXCR4的表达,采用图像分析软件系统对免疫组织化学结果进行半定量分析。结果:①TFF3蛋白表达于癌细胞胞质,癌旁滤泡上皮细胞TFF3阴性或弱阳性,TFF3阳性率92.39%,其中临床Ⅲ~Ⅳ期强阳性率为71.19%(42/59),Ⅰ~Ⅱ期强阳性率为33.33%(11/33,P〈0.01);有淋巴结转移者明显高于无淋巴结转移者(100.00%vs 86.27%,P〈0.05)。TFF3的AOD值在PTC内高于癌旁、有淋巴结转移者高于无淋巴结转移者、临床Ⅲ~Ⅳ期高于Ⅰ~Ⅱ期(P〈0.05或P〈0.01)。②SDF-1表达于胞质,转移淋巴结和癌旁细胞为弱阳性或阴性。SDF-1阳性率和AOD值在PTC内高于癌旁、有淋巴结转移者高于无淋巴结转移者、临床Ⅲ~Ⅳ期高于Ⅰ~Ⅱ期、45岁以上高于45岁以下者(P〈0.05或P〈0.01);CXCR4主要表达于胞质,少数表达于胞核,癌旁组织中呈弱阳性或阴性,PTC中CXCR4表达的阳性率和AOD值与SDF-1相似:癌内高于癌旁、与临床分级、淋巴结转移和年龄有关(P〈0.05或P〈0.01)。③PTC中,TFF3与SDF-1蛋白、SDF-1与CXCR4蛋白表达水平呈正相关(r=0.971,P〈0.01)。结论:TFF3、SDF-1、CXCR4在PTC中的高表达与癌的发生、发展有关,对判断PTC的恶性程度和病情进展有重要价值。

Abstract:Objective:To study the expression of trefoil factor 3(TFF3)with stromal cell-derived factor(SDF- 1) and its receptor (CXCR4) in papillary thyroid carcinoma(PTC), and investigate the function of TFF3,SDF-1/ CXCR4 and the relationship among them during the tumor genesis,development and outcome of PTC. Method:De- tecting the expression of TFF3 and SDF-1/CXCR4 by immunohistochemieal method(SP) in 92 cases of PTC and para-earcinoma tissue. Semiquantitative analysis of the results of immunohistochemistry was conducted by image analysis software. Result: @TFF3 protein was expressed in the cytoplasm of cancer cells, while TFF3 was negtive or weakly positive in folieular cells of para-carcinoma tissue. The positive expression rate of TFF3 was 92.39% ,of which the strong positive rate of clinical stage ]]I --iV accounted for 71.79~ (42/59) and that of clinical stage I -- II was 33.33%(11/33)(P*~0. 01). The positive rate of TFF3 was significantly higher in the cases with lymph node metastasis than those without lymph node metastasis(100.00~ vs 86. 270/00 ,P(0.05). The AOD value of TFF3 was higher in PTC than in para-carcinoma tissue, that in cases with lymph node metastasis was higher than those without lymph node metastasis, and that in stage ]]I- IV was higher than those in I -- ]I (P(0.05 or P( 0.05). ~There was high expression of SDF-1 in the cytoplasm of malignant tissues. The para-carcinoma tissue was weakly positive or negative to SDF 1 and metastatic lymph nodes was weakly positive to SDF 1. The positive rates and AOD values of SDF-1 protein were similar to those of TFF3 in PTC,that is to say the positive rate and AOD values were higher in PTC than in para-carcinoma tissue, those in cases with lymph node metastasis were higher than those without lymph node metastasis, those in stage m - 1v were higher than those in I - II, and those in patients older than 45 years" old was obviously higher than those in patients under 45 years" old(P〈0.05 or P〈0.01);CXCR4 was also mainly expressed in cytoplasm with few expression in nuclei, while negative or weakly positive in para-carcinoma. The positive rate and AOD values of CXCR4 in PTC were similar to SDF-1, meaning that they were higher in PTC than in para-carcinoma tissue and associated with the clinical stage, lymph node metastasis and age(P〈0.05 or P〈0. 01). @There was positive relationship between TFF3 and SDF-1 as well as between SDF-1 and CXCR4 in PTC(r=0. 971 ,P〈O. 01). Conclusion:The high expression of TFF3 ,SDF-1 and CXCR4 in PTC are correlated with carcinogenesis and progression, and may play a significant role in evalua- ting the malignancy degree and progression of PTC.
